The Mount Helen Residence was designed as a contemporary family home responding to its open landscape and regional context. The layout prioritises orientation, views, and natural light, with living spaces positioned to engage with the surrounding environment while maintaining privacy from neighbouring properties.

The architectural language is restrained and purposeful, using simple forms and a clear spatial hierarchy to create a calm, functional home suited to long-term occupation.

The design emphasises connection to landscape through controlled openings, sheltered outdoor areas, and a strong relationship between interior and exterior spaces. Material selection was guided by durability and low maintenance, ensuring the home performs well across seasonal changes typical of the Ballarat region.

The result is a considered residential project that balances openness with comfort, and contemporary design with a grounded, regional sensibility.
